Salary
💰 $62,000 - $102,300 per year
Tech Stack
AngularETLJavaScriptJenkinsNode.jsReactSQLVue.jsWebpack
About the role
- Analyze data to design and build BI dashboards (in React.Js and Looker) in short timeframes via rapid prototyping and agile development to provide insights that support business decisions.
- Hands on development, and maintenance of all aspects of BI solutions – ETL, Data Quality, Visualisation, Documentation, and Production movement.
- Analyze data to provide insights.
- Collaborate with stakeholders to understand their data needs.
- Deliver recommendations based on data analysis.
- Ensure data accuracy and integrity in all analysis processes.
- Present findings to stakeholders.
- Drive continuous improvement in data analysis practices.
Requirements
- Minimum of 2 years of relevant work experience and a Bachelor's degree or equivalent experience.
- 4~6 years of experience with full-stack development supporting both frontend/backend development
- 3+ years of hands-on experience in React.js development
- 3+ years of hands-on experience in Looker or similar BI tool-based development
- Proficient with SQL
- Proficient with React.Js and other front-end frameworks (e.g. Angular, Vue)
- Proficient with Functional and Object-Oriented JavaScript/ES6+ coding
- Proficient with Node.JS and Express application design and development
- Proficient with HTML5 and CSS3
- Experience with RESTful web services
- Experience with BI tools such as Looker is an added advantage
- Proficient with Webpack and other build and packaging systems
- Proficient in writing automated unit and functional tests
- Proficient with Git source control and effective branching and release management practices
- Proficient in creating web user interfaces and resolving cross-browser and backward compatibility issues
- Ability to debug, diagnose and resolve complex JavaScript bugs throughout the stack
- Exceptional communication and collaboration skills to engage with multiple stakeholders and different teams to deliver BI solutions efficiently
- Strong critical thinking skills; ability to devise innovative solutions
- Bonus Skills: Experience with Sales Force CRMA development
- Bonus Skills: Experience with Looker REST APIs and Extension Framework
- Bonus Skills: Experience with continuous integration and delivery tools such as Jenkins
- Bonus Skills: Experience in the Fintech/Banking/Credit/Payment industry is a strong plus